如何在创建之前在合并请求中查找冲突
How to find Conflicts in merge request before create
如何在创建合并请求之前找到 git 冲突?
我想在创建合并请求并推送之前找到冲突。如果我测试合并而不是冲突退出分支合并,我不想要那个。
您可以尝试将基础分支合并到您的功能分支(反之亦然),看看是否存在冲突:
git fetch origin
git merge --no-commit origin/the-base-branch
if [ $? -ne 0 ]; then
echo there are conflicts
fi
如何在创建合并请求之前找到 git 冲突? 我想在创建合并请求并推送之前找到冲突。如果我测试合并而不是冲突退出分支合并,我不想要那个。
您可以尝试将基础分支合并到您的功能分支(反之亦然),看看是否存在冲突:
git fetch origin
git merge --no-commit origin/the-base-branch
if [ $? -ne 0 ]; then
echo there are conflicts
fi